Is indian fleabane edible?
Yes, indian fleabane leaves are traditionally consumed in some cultures, often used in salads, soups, or as a vegetable side dish. However, always ensure correct identification and consult local food safety guidelines or a healthcare professional before consumption, as plant edibility can vary.
